Step 1: Emergency Assessment and Containment

Our technicians will arrive at your property, assess the situation, and contain the affected area to prevent further water damage. This step typically takes 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the severity of the situation.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

Using industrial-grade pumps and vacuums, our team will remove excess water from the affected area, followed by the use of desiccant dehumidifiers to dry the space. This step can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the extent of the damage.

Step 3: Water Damage Repair and Restoration

Once the area is completely dry, our technicians will assess and repair any dam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and structural parts.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 days, depending on the extent of the repairs.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ect the space to prevent mold growth and leave your property smelling fresh and clean.

Fire Sprinkler Discharge Water Removal Cost In Sun City Festival, AZ

The cost of fire sprinkler discharge water removal can vary depending on the severity of the situation,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sun City Festival, AZ.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ved and can make an informed decision.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ency assessment and containment $500-$2,500 Severity of the situation, size of the affected area
Water removal and drying $1,000-$5,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ment required
Water damage repair and restoration $2,000-$10,000 Extent of the damage, materials required for repairs
Final inspection and cleaning $500-$2,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ment required

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ment by our team. We offer free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ved and can make an informed decision.
